Previously I had a 97' Toyota land cruiser. I also did the 5.3L swap. iron block with 4l60e trans.
On the D2 I am planing on doing 5.3L amluminum block with 6L80e trans.
Currently I am going through the electrical library and manuals to see what problems i will run into with BCU and GM set up.
I am also determining of which engine accessories to use. I hope to stay with D2 a/c compressor, P/S pump , and Alt.
I am also figuring out how to keep the ACE. Or just go with regualr sway bars.
